RADIANT SHINES AT FS/TEC
At the Foodservice Technology (FS/TEC) show last month in Long Beach, Calif., Radiant Systems demonstrated its latest POS terminal, self-service kiosk and back-office technology for food-service operators.

The Radiant P1500 Series POS terminal features a 15-inch touch screen, Intel Centrino mobile technology and Windows XP.

"A key goal in food service is to provide fast, consistent service to customers," said Scott Kingsfield, vice president of Atlanta-based Radiant. "Our technology helps operators meet this challenge."

SYMBOL, AMERANTH TEAM UP FOR CUSTOMER SERVICE
Symbol Technologies, Holtsville, N.Y., and Ameranth Wireless, San Diego, have joined forces to deliver Wi-Fi networking solutions to Medieval Times dinner theaters across the United States and the NBA City Restaurant in Orlando, Fla.

Using Symbol PPT 8800 PDAs bundled with Microsoft's Windows Mobile 2003 and software from Ameranth, wait staff at Medieval Times restaurants,where patrons are seated around a full-size jousting arena,and at NBA City will now be able to take orders at the tables and immediately transmit that information to the kitchen and POS system.
